Vævsceller, or tissue cells, are the fundamental building blocks of all tissues in multicellular organisms. They are specialized cells that perform specific functions within a particular tissue. For example, muscle cells are specialized for contraction, nerve cells for transmitting electrical signals, and epithelial cells for forming protective linings and absorbing substances.
